Career path

Career Role Description
Sustainable Aquaculture Technician Monitoring fish health, water quality, and feeding regimes in sustainable aquaculture facilities. Essential for environmentally responsible fish farming.
Aquaculture Sustainability Manager Overseeing all aspects of sustainability in aquaculture operations, implementing best practices and ensuring compliance with regulations. A key role in responsible aquaculture management.
Research Scientist (Sustainable Aquaculture) Conducting research to improve sustainable aquaculture practices, developing new technologies, and contributing to the advancement of environmentally friendly fish farming. Crucial for innovation in the sector.
Sustainable Aquaculture Consultant Advising aquaculture businesses on best practices for sustainability, helping them to improve their environmental performance and achieve certification. Provides expert guidance on responsible aquaculture.
